Group convolution in CARN

Open qingchuanhuajuan opened this issue 6 years ago • 3 comments

Hello there You have proposed two models, CARN and CARN-M. Figures 2 and 3 of your paper, and paragraph 3 of the paper, show that the residual block in your CARN uses residual-E. But in your code, only CARN-M uses group convolution. The residual module used by CARN is just a normal convolution rather than a group convolution. But the last paragraph of Section 4.4 of your paper mentions that the PSNR of CARN is 28.7. I don't understand this value, it is not found in Table 1. So, is your CARN model the same as described in the code?

qingchuanhuajuan avatar Mar 18 '19 09:03 qingchuanhuajuan

Hi.

  1. Only CARN-M uses residual-e block (group convs) as in the code.
  2. In the section 4.4, PSNR of CARN is only calculated for the ablation study so that we decrease the training steps and so on.
